1. A passive entry system comprising:

  • an unlocking module that is integrated in a vehicle of a first group of vehicles and configured to perform a key operation in a keyless environment, the unlocking module comprising;

    a control module that determines a range of identification values, including a start of range value and an end of range value, that generates an authentication request packet based on the range of identification values and a first group identification value, and that broadcasts the request packet, wherein the first group identification value is common to the first group of vehicles; and

    a plurality of fobs that are in communication with the first group of vehicles and configured to trigger the unlocking module to perform the key operation, each fob having a unique identification value associated thereto and a second group identification value associated thereto, each fob comprising;

    a fob transceiver that receives the request packet; and

    a response module that determines if the first group identification value corresponds to the second group identification value, and that determines whether the unique identification value of the corresponding fob falls within the range of identification values only if the first group identification value corresponds to the second group identification value, and that generates a response packet if the unique identification value falls within the range of identification values, wherein the fob transceiver transmits the response packet to the control module;

    wherein the control module is configured to receive response packets from the plurality of fobs, analyze response packets received from fobs having even unique identification values separately from response packets received from fobs having odd unique identification values, and to perform the key operation based on one of the received response packets.
